Hey, have you seen the new trailer for Disney & Pixar’s “Inside Out 2” yet? If not, you’re in for a treat! Set to hit theaters on June 14th, this sequel dives back into the wonderfully chaotic world inside Riley’s head.
But wait, there’s a twist this time around! Alongside the familiar crew of emotions—Joy, Sadness, Anger, Fear, and Disgust—a new character is stepping onto the scene: Anxiety. And let me tell you, Anxiety isn’t here to play it safe. Voiced by Maya Hawke, she’s ready to shake things up in headquarters.
Director Kelsey Mann gives us the inside scoop, saying, “Anxiety might be new, but she’s definitely not taking a back seat.” It’s a fresh take that promises to add a whole new layer of depth to the story. After all, who hasn’t had their fair share of anxious moments?

Returning to Riley’s mind as she navigates the challenges of being a teenager, this sequel promises laughs, tears, and everything in between. And with talents like Amy Poehler, Phyllis Smith, Lewis Black, Tony Hale, and Liza Lapira lending their voices to the beloved characters, you know you’re in for a treat.
